背景情况:
- 结肠直肠癌 (CCR) 是欧洲的一个重大公共卫生问题.
- 在2022年,CCR在乳腺癌之后,成为该地区第二大被诊断的癌症.
研究的目的:
- 分析欧洲结直肠癌的发病率和趋势.
- 突出结直肠癌带来的公共卫生负担.
主要方法:
- 流行病学数据分析.
- 欧洲国家癌症发病率统计数据的综述.
主要成果:
- 结肠直肠癌 (CCR) 在2022年在欧洲显示出第二高的发病率.
- 乳腺癌是唯一具有更高发病率的癌症.
结论:
- 结直肠癌 (CCR) 的高发病率凸显了加强查和预防计划的必要性.
- 持续的监测和研究对于打击欧洲结直肠癌的负担至关重要.

Tumor Progression
6.2K
Tumor progression is a phenomenon where the pre-formed tumor acquires successive mutations to become clinically more aggressive and malignant. In the 1950s, Foulds first described the stepwise progression of cancer cells through successive stages.
Colon cancer is one of the best-documented examples of tumor progression. Early mutation in the APC gene in colon cells causes a small growth on the colon wall called a polyp. With time, this polyp grows into a benign, pre-cancerous tumor. Further...
